ay-TV provider Multichoice Group has ceded a 30 percent stake in its subsidiary GOtv Kenya Limited to unnamed local investors who did not pay for the shares.

The transaction, which reduced the South Africa pay-television giant's ownership in the business to 70 percent, was done to comply with local ownership rules.

The multinational did not name the Kenyan investors who took up the shares.
